Abstract

The present invention effectively compensates gain wavelength dependency of optical amplifiers by a simple method. That is, a value smaller than the minimum value of gain, in the range of usage wavelengths, of gain wavelength dependency data of the optical amplifiers is predetermined as a reference gain value. A loss wavelength characteristic which counterbalances the gain greater than the reference gain value is provided as an ideal loss wavelength characteristic which completely compensates the gain wavelength dependency.
